|
亲!马上注册或者登录会查看更多内容!
您需要 登录 才可以下载或查看,没有帐号?立即注册
x
本帖最后由 Sophia 于 6-6-2016 01:07 AM 编辑
/ ^: O( y8 r, f9 \5 _. t+ N! c4 {: _
lz三月份面了四家, 最后除了Houzz都拿到了offer,发个面经回报群里% }$ J0 |2 z+ w# L
9 z# ~* N! a( [, }
1. Google
+ F' z6 s$ r9 V [: s/ e# LPhone: 给一个array从1~N里面缺一个数,如何找到 + mirror tree + design auto complete# p! N$ d) {3 o% L$ X* k1 f0 T
Onsite: Interleaving Iterator;3 f0 B6 ?$ E& ~% c, C: y5 k0 l
++-- game;& m" X7 j l( N) R) w
permutation 变形
+ X3 A' F/ }, \7 r longest consecutive increaing path in BT (FOLLOW UP: 有向无环图和无向有环图)
; E8 [! R2 M5 [3 W, P* b given keywords and frequency, generate random number based on weight distribution' d3 f; [( |9 }4 H2 _
一周之后给了正式offer/ b0 n5 V# o$ W) W% {/ U: D
9 f- g- c6 W% O) [) ~2 I! ]2 M2. Square! u: L2 ^/ d: }" ~
Phone 1:implement two methods, add() and getRange(int lower, int upper)
- I2 k0 M* q N- f; @7 R( v, QPhone 2 n个人刷卡,m个人被拒了k刀,求出所有被拒的人
u6 }9 K5 x3 @& \Onsite: given a text(with punctuations) and keywords, find the frequency && find the nth max keywords( L: l% v+ R$ |- y8 Y Y& n6 Y! |
implements Html Object and some functions
! O$ a% x9 \9 W* {一周之后给了offer,已经锯掉了
/ @! |1 ?- N( P6 I& j* M# w
' W, F- {) M* x3. Snapchat, k: `% f# O4 ?8 B* e, _
Onsite:1. snapchat discover design + word search + product except self) F/ F$ v8 m! {0 o6 Q/ v; j
2. talk about RTB and project,Ip filters and how to scale to 5000 rules# U$ h- U8 W1 F( ]
3. talk about RTB and project,implement snapchat client user selection feature) D F6 b E4 f) }$ K7 J6 I) g
4. talk about RTB and project,3 sum
/ P% G( ?* D; e" Y7 `. @. | }面完之后一个小时打电话给了offer,ads组做RTB,最后还是没去。。
+ q9 @- K5 m0 v& r8 d最后lz选择了google,现已入职,现在为版内还在找工作的筒子们提供内推,请发送你感兴趣的职位,resume,以及一小段第三人称的自我介绍到guglerefer@gmail.com,lz会尽量及时帮助内推以及回复。。。1 H' ~7 R- L$ A
% B! o' w. M( k; D4 j$ @0 ]/ d& h2 [
, v: H; D2 J q, n5 y
0 U7 L# i* [- z! J- U% i0 L: D- P. `8 F+ ~& u8 _3 o
|
评分
-
查看全部评分
|